Botox

Neurotoxins are injectable compounds designed to relax muscles, effectively smoothing out lines and wrinkles. Among the various brands available, BOTOX® Cosmetic is one of the most recognized.



BOTOX® Cosmetic specifically targets areas of the face and neck to alleviate muscle tension and diminish the appearance of lines and wrinkles. At Elle Medical & Aesthetics, we offer it for a range of treatments. In addition to BOTOX®, we also utilize other neurotoxin options like Xeomin® and Dysport®. Typically, the effects of these cosmetic treatments last for three to four months.

What to Expect During Treatment


First, we will develop a personalized treatment plan tailored specifically for you. Since the effects of neurotoxins are temporary, your plan will likely include 3 to 4 sessions per year to achieve and maintain optimal results.


BOTOX® Cosmetic is delivered through a series of targeted injections that typically take about 15 minutes to complete. Following the procedure, there will be a brief waiting period to monitor for any rare adverse reactions. After this, you can return to your regular activities. You may experience minor swelling or redness, but these usually subside quickly.

What Are the Results of BOTOX® Cosmetic Treatments?

Most individuals start to notice their lines smoothing within 24 to 48 hours after treatment. Improvements continue for several days, leading to the best possible results. The effects typically last for three to four months before requiring a follow-up treatment.   • What’s the difference between Botox, Xeomin, and Dysport?

    All three are FDA-approved neuromodulators that temporarily relax facial muscles. Botox is the most well-known. Xeomin is a purified form without accessory proteins. Dysport tends to spread more, which can make it ideal for larger areas. During your consultation, we will help you decide which product is best for your goals and anatomy.

  • Does Botox hurt?

    Most clients describe Botox injections as a mild pinch or brief pressure. Treatments are quick, typically taking 10 to 15 minutes. We use a fine needle and can apply a numbing agent if needed, though most patients find it very tolerable.

  • How soon will I see results from Botox?

    Initial results may appear within 24 to 48 hours. Full results typically develop over 7 to 10 days. The effects usually last about 3 to 4 months, depending on your body’s response and the area treated.

  • What should I avoid after getting Botox?

    For the first four hours after treatment, avoid lying flat, rubbing the treated area, applying pressure, or exercising. We also recommend avoiding saunas, alcohol, and facials for 24 hours. You will receive clear aftercare instructions before you leave the office.

  • What is a Lip Flip or Gummy Smile treatment with Botox?

    These are targeted Botox injections used to relax specific muscles around the mouth. A Lip Flip slightly rolls out the upper lip for a fuller appearance. A Gummy Smile treatment reduces how much gum shows when you smile. Both are subtle enhancements that can be done without filler.

  • What happens if I stop getting Botox?

    If you stop Botox, your results will gradually wear off and your facial expressions will return to baseline. Your skin will not look worse than before treatment, but lines may slowly return with normal movement over time.
